What does SBA loan mean?

An SBA loan is a loan backed by the U.S. Small Business Administration. This backing reduces risk for lenders. It often means better terms for borrowers. Businesses in places like Roanoke can use these loans for many purposes.

Is SBA a legitimate company?

The Small Business Administration is a U.S. government agency. It's a legitimate entity created to support small businesses. We work with SBA-approved lenders to help businesses across Virginia access these valuable resources.
